More action and adventure in the future-shocked world of Judge Dredd! A shocking revelation about a former Chief Judge is splashed across the Mega-City media in "Father's Day"; Psi-Judge Anderson's cadets battle for their lives in the finale to "The Dead Run"; undead curator Henry Dubble introduces another twisted Black Museum tale in "Big Marilyn"; Nia makes a fateful choice in the last episode of "Diamond Dogs"; and The Returners must stop a terrifying evil escaping in "Chandhu." + this issues bagged comic is: the fight against the alien invaders reaches its conclusion in volume two of Damnation Station by Al Ewing (The Immortal Hulk) and Mark Harrison (Durham Red)!
